Abstract
In this paper, thermoluminescence (TL) properties such as glow curves analysis, dose response linearity and some dosimetric characteristics of pure and carbon doped lanthanum aluminate (LaAlO3) produced by different syntheses using the solid state reaction method are investigated, after exposure to different UV radiation doses. The effect of different syntheses on the TL glow curves structures is also investigated and discussed. TL glow-curve deconvolution (CGD) methods and the Chen's peak shape methods were used to analyze the sets of TL glow curves. The kinetic parameters of TL single peaks were computed. Additionally, the life times (Ï) of electrons in trap for all samples were determined and calculated. A good linear dose response over the dose range from 0.21 to 1.26Â mJ/cm2 has been attributed to both samples (B and C).
